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cachorrinho | mottled pug |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(cordados) | Arthropoda (artrópode) |
| Class | Mammalia (mamíferos) | Insecta (inseto) |
| Order | Carnivora (carnívoros)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) | Geometridae |
| Genus | Speothos | Eupithecia |
| Species | Speothos venaticus | Eupithecia exiguata |
Evolutionary Relationship
Cachorrinho and mottled pug share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
